#3d6ebb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3d6ebb is composed of 23.9% red, 43.1%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.4% cyan, 41.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 216.7 degrees, a saturation of 50.8% and a lightness of 48.6%. #3d6ebb color hex could be obtained by blending #7adcff with #000077.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#3d6ebb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#3d6ebb has RGB values of R:61, G:110, B:187 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0.41, Y:0,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 4026043.

Shades and Tints of #3d6ebb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03060a is the darkest color, while #fafb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#3d6ebb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#767b82 is the less saturated color, while #0461f4 is the most saturated one.
